Newton
Overview
Newton is a vibrant and diverse neighbourhood in the city of Surrey, British Columbia. Its multicultural essence is reflected in its variety of restaurants, shops, and community events, creating a lively atmosphere for residents and visitors alike. Known for its strong sense of community, Newton attracts families, young professionals, and retirees looking for a balanced suburban lifestyle close to the amenities of metropolitan life. The area is conveniently located near major transportation routes, including the Newton Exchange, a major bus hub that connects residents to broader Surrey and beyond.
Proximity to other key areas such as Langley and Maple Ridge, as well as quick access into Surrey’s central business district, makes Newton an ideal place for those seeking accessibility without sacrificing the charm of a residential neighbourhood. Its cultural richness and welcoming environment make Newton a hub for community interaction, economic activity, and recreational opportunities.

Parks & Recreation
For those who cherish outdoor activities, Newton doesn't disappoint. The area boasts several parks and recreational facilities, including Unwin Park and Newton Athletic Park, which offer sports fields, walking trails, and playgrounds. The Newton Wave Pool provides a unique aquatic experience with its wave generation facilities, making it a popular destination for children and families. With ample green spaces and state-of-the-art sports complexes, Newton encourages a healthy and active lifestyle for all its residents.

Transit & Commute
Newton's transportation network is robust, providing residents with seamless connections throughout Surrey and the Greater Vancouver area. The Newton Exchange is a key transit node, offering bus routes that connect to the SkyTrain system for efficient commutes into downtown Vancouver and surrounding locations. For those who prefer driving, Newton is located near several major arterials, including King George Boulevard and the Fraser Highway, facilitating quick and easy commutes into neighbouring cities like Langley and Surrey's city centre.
